    Reviewing a fashion and style gallery of Kajol and Shah Rukh Khan (SRK) is essentially a journey through the evolution of modern Bollywood style. Their on-screen partnership has not only defined cinematic romance but also set enduring fashion trends that resonate across generations. The "Golden Era" Impact (1990s)

    The 90s established their most recognizable style tropes, which galleries often highlight as cultural touchstones:

    Sporty and Preppy: In Kuch Kuch Hota Hai (1998), the duo popularized "preppy" American-inspired fashion. SRK’s metallic "COOL" necklace and Kajol’s tomboyish dungarees with elastic headbands became instant nationwide hits among college students. Kajol With Shahrukh Khan Nude Fucking Hard Images WORK

    The Swiss Aesthetic: Dilwale Dulhania Le Jayenge (1995) defined the romantic "sojourn in Switzerland" look. Galleries frequently showcase Kajol’s adventurous headgear—from floppy sun hats to knitted berets—paired with SRK's classic leather jackets and boots.

    Bold Colors: Kajol often eschewed traditional bridal reds for saturated hues, such as her iconic green mehendi outfit in DDLJ, which remains a popular moodboard reference today. Mature Elegance and Nostalgia (2000s–Present)
